Abstract

The invention discloses a traditional Chinese medicine for treating skin diseases and a preparation method thereof, which pertain to the technical field of Chinese medical pharmaceutical technology. The traditional Chinese medicine comprises the raw medicines of: 9 to 11 portions of kuh-seng, 9 to 11 portions of cyrtomium fortunei, 9 to 11 portions of honeysuckle, 9 to 11 portions of chrysanthemum, 4 to 6 portions of cicada skins, 4 to 6 portions of fresh licorice, 4 to 6 portions of fructus xanthii, 2 to 4 portions of amoorcorn tree bark and 2 to 4 portions of fructus kochiae, wherein the mixture ratio of the raw medicines is weight ratio. The preparation method of the traditional Chinese medicine is vinegar processing method. The traditional Chinese medicine has the functions of clearing heat and drying damp, clearing away heat and toxic materials, cooling blood, dispelling wind and removing heat, removing damp and relieving itching and has great treatment effect on the skin diseases such as whelk, eczema, skin itch, psoriasis, purpura, dermatophytosis, lupus sebaceus and the like, is the good medicine for treating skin diseases and can be used for treating the skin diseases.

Embodiment 5
Present embodiment is treated dermopathic preparation method of Chinese medicine: take by weighing described Radix Sophorae Flavescentis 9~11 grams, Rhizoma Osmundae 9~11 grams, Flos Lonicerae 9~11 grams, Flos Chrysanthemi 9~11 grams, Periostracum Cicadae 4~6 grams, Radix Glycyrrhizae 4~6 grams, Fructus Xanthii 4~6 grams, Cortex Phellodendri 2~4 grams, the Fructus Kochiae 2~4 grams respectively, medicinal vinegar in described is concocted.
Embodiment 6
Present embodiment is treated dermopathic preparation method of Chinese medicine: take by weighing Cortex Phellodendri 0.7 gram, the Fructus Kochiae 0.7 gram that described Radix Sophorae Flavescentis 19 grams, Rhizoma Osmundae 19 grams, Flos Lonicerae 19 grams, Flos Chrysanthemi 19 grams, Periostracum Cicadae 11 grams, Radix Glycyrrhizae 11 grams, Fructus Xanthii 11 grams, described saline are fried out respectively, with the described medicine that the takes by weighing mix homogeneously of claying into power, described vinegar is slowly poured in the described hybrid medicine, and evenly stir simultaneously, become to help making the pasty state of pill, the pill of synthetic nine grammes per square metres up to medicine.
Described vinegar shines three days vinegar continuously for to be exposed to the sun under the sun two division of day and night at noon in summer.
The present invention treats dermopathic usage of Chinese materia medica and consumption is: oral, and each ball of morning and evening, (medicine) being taken before meal is used.
Curative effect determinate standard of the present invention is as follows:
Cure: disease disappears, not recurrence more than a year;
Obviously take effect: disease obviously alleviates;
Take effect: disease slightly alleviates;
Invalid: no change.
The present invention can take effect to general dermatosis on the 7th, to the obvious effect of refractory skin 20 daybreaks.
Illustrate the clinical therapeutic efficacy that the present invention treats dermopathic Chinese medicine below:
Sub-commune hospital puts into practice in dermatosis patient 181 examples at the white mausoleum of Tu Zuoqi, cures 168 examples, 12 examples that obviously take effect, and invalid 1 example, its rate that heals is up to 92.8%.
Its example that specifically takes effect is exemplified as:
Beam xx, 60 years old, people from Shandong suffered from psoriasis universalis 30 years, and outpatient service on October 6 in 2005 is sought medical advice.Took the present invention one month, pruritus obviously alleviates, and continues to take three months, obviously takes effect, and pruritus disappears, and it is normal that skin recovers, and obeys half a year again continuously, so far recurrence never;
Well xx 41 years old, suffers from allergic dermatitis for many years, though can cure annual recurrence in spring.Came outpatient service to go to a doctor on August 5th, 2006, took the present invention one month, obviously take effect, obeyed again two months, so far recurrence never.
Indication of the present invention is: refractory skins such as comedo, eczema, skin pruritus, psoriasis, purpura, beriberi, erythema blue wolf.
